什么是苹果应用签名?

苹果应用签名是指应用程序在安装和运行时,需要进行的数字签名验证过程。在 IOS 系统中,为了保障应用程序安全性和防止盗版软件的出现,苹果公司设定了应用签名制度。这一制度使得所有的应用程序在向 IOS 系统提交并下载时,必须通过苹果的签名认证,否则无法被运行。

为什么要签名应用?

苹果应用签名是一种保护应用程序安全的措施,通过数字签名验证,可以确保软件来源可信并且未被篡改过苹果证书撤销是什么意思。在安装应用过程中,若签名验证失败,则该应用程序无法被运行,保护用户的设备免受恶意软件的攻击。苹果如何删除证书信息

常见的苹果签名方式

目前,常见的苹果签名方式主要包括三种:个人签名、企业签名和苹果开发者签名。其中,个人签名需要使用自己的开发者账号进行签名,适合个人开发者和小团队使用。企业签名则对于一些大型机构或企业来说更加方便,可以将签名和证书直接授予企业,并为企业提供管理网站系统。苹果开发者签名则是一种灵活的签名方式,可由苹果授权的第三方开发者代为签名,适合中小型企业和独立开发者使用。

如何创建IOS应用签名苹果证书信任在哪里设置的呢?

在 IOS 应用程序签名前,首先需要获取一个苹果开发者账户,并下载 Xcode 工具,这样就可以获取到各种签名证书以及相关的私钥了。然后,通过 Xcode 工具中的“证书、标识与配置文件”选项,可以对应用进行签名。在签名完成后,即可提交应用到 Apple Store 进行审核和发布了。

iOS签名如何更新?

随着 IOS 系统的升级和版本更替,应用程序的签名证书也需要不断更新,否则应用程序可能会因为签名验证失败而无法正常运行。因此,需要定期更新 IOS 签名证书。一般情况下,苹果会提前通知所有开发者和管理员证书即将过期,并提供相应的更新方法。开发者只需要更新证书即可,无需更改或重新发布应用程序。

如何选择合适的签名方式?

选择合适的签名方式主要根据实际情况来决定,对于个人开发者和小型团队,个人签名或者企业签名都比较适合;而对于大型企业或者机构,则应该选择具有定制性和规模性的签名方式。另外,还需要考虑到签名所涉及的费用、安全性、管理和维护等方面。

结论

???果应用签名和 IOS 签名是保障应用安全的重要措施,对于开发者、企业和用户而言都具有很强的意义。通过了解和掌握签名的相关知识和方法,可以更好地保障软件的安全性,从而为用户带来更好的使用体验。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。